If you're more of a DIY enthusiast, don't worry, you can still achieve a professional look at home! It just takes a bit more patience and the right tools. Invest in good quality polishes – they apply smoother and last longer. Using a thin brush for details and a good cleanup brush with acetone can help you get those sharp edges. Practice makes perfect, so don't get discouraged if your first attempt isn't salon-perfect. I’ve definitely had my share of trial-and-error moments! Another tip for keeping your Halloween nails professional, especially if you work in an office or a more formal setting, is to consider more subtle or elegant designs. Instead of overtly gory scenes, think about sophisticated black and gold accents, a minimalist ghost on a nude base, or even a chic ombré in Halloween colors like deep purples and oranges. French tips with a tiny bat silhouette or a subtle glitter gradient can be incredibly classy while still festive. It's all about finding designs that express your holiday spirit without compromising your everyday style. Finally, don't forget about nail health and maintenance. Even the most elaborate Halloween design won't look professional if your cuticles are dry or your nails are chipped. Keep them moisturized, use a good base coat to protect your natural nails, and reapply a top coat every few days to extend the life of your manicure. This not only makes your nails last longer but also ensures they always look well-cared for, regardless of the spooky art on them.
